Imported Upstream version 4.0.0~alpha1

Former-commit-id: 806294f5ded97629b74c85c09952f2a74fe182d9
This commit is contained in:
Jo Shields
2015-04-07 09:35:12 +01:00
parent 283343f570
commit 3c1f479b9d
22469 changed files with 2931443 additions and 869343 deletions

View File

@ -201,14 +201,12 @@ namespace MonoTests.System.Xml
document.LoadXml (xml);
xnr = new XmlNodeReader (document);
method (xnr);
#if NET_2_0
/*
// XPathNavigatorReader tests
System.Xml.XPath.XPathDocument doc = new System.Xml.XPath.XPathDocument (new StringReader (xml));
XmlReader xpr = doc.CreateNavigator ().ReadSubtree ();
method (xpr);
*/
#endif
}
@ -1513,7 +1511,6 @@ namespace MonoTests.System.Xml
reader.Read (); // silently returns false
}
#if NET_2_0
[Test]
public void CreateSimple ()
{
@ -1756,6 +1753,19 @@ namespace MonoTests.System.Xml
Assert.AreEqual (3, count, "#3");
}
[Test, Category("NotWorking")]
public void ReadToNextSiblingInInitialReadState ()
{
var xml = "<Text name=\"hello\"><Something></Something></Text>";
var ms = new MemoryStream(Encoding.Default.GetBytes(xml));
var xtr = XmlReader.Create(ms);
Assert.AreEqual(xtr.ReadState, ReadState.Initial);
xtr.ReadToNextSibling("Text");
Assert.AreEqual("hello", xtr.GetAttribute("name"));
}
[Test]
public void ReadSubtree ()
{
@ -2336,7 +2346,6 @@ namespace MonoTests.System.Xml
if (task.Result != null)
throw task.Result;
}
#endif
#endif
}
}